Job details
Here’s how the job details align with your profile.Pay
- $75,000 a year
Job type
- Full-time
Shift and schedule
- Monday to Friday
Location
BenefitsPulled from the full job description
- Paid time off
- Stock options
Full job description
About MoveMate
At MoveMate, we strive to become the go-to app for moving and delivery of large objects across North-America.
We have created a two-sided marketplace that connects individuals and businesses with a moving or delivery need with independent contractors called “Mates” that have the tools, the manpower, and the vehicle necessary to facilitate the service.
MoveMate is revolutionizing the way large items are delivered to both businesses and consumers in North-America. Since launching in 2019, revenue growth has been substantial. We have quintupled our revenue in 2022 and are well on track for continued success in the future. We pride ourselves on our innovative approach and use of technology to streamline the delivery process for our clients.
Our team is made up of dynamic, driven individuals who are passionate about making a difference in the logistics industry. We offer a fast-paced and collaborative work environment where you will have the opportunity to make a real impact on the growth of the company.
MoveMate’s Values
At MoveMate, we pride ourselves on staying true to our values at all times. We are constantly re-evaluating these principles to ensure that they reflect the culture we seek to maintain.
1. Grit
At MoveMate, we train our employees to harness their entrepreneurial spirit to spur innovation and problem-solving that will continuously improve our products and services, and enable quick thinking when our clients need assistance. Employees are given significant autonomy with the understanding that additional sweat is compensated with additional reward.
2. Impact
At MoveMate, our sweat-equity framework succeeds because our team believes in MoveMate’s vision; they understand that their work is a part of a larger ambition of what the world can become: efficient and eco-friendly. MoveMate pictures a world where businesses and customers will use MoveMate to transport their goods due to our advanced logistical capabilities that will reduce road congestion and optimize delivery routes to ensure that all cars and trucks are traveling full. We want to make an impact globally by contributing to the creation of smarter cities that take a multidimensional approach to sustainability.
3. Transparency
MoveMate is committed to being open and honest about all aspects of our services. It is our objective to make every part of our booking process and our pricing model transparent so that our clients know exactly what they are being charged and why, as well as how to properly prepare for a move.
4. Diversity
At MoveMate, we have committed ourselves to diversifying our workplace at the executive, managerial, consultant, and analyst/intern levels. We recognize the value of having a variety of perspectives at our table, and understand that having a representation of diverse backgrounds, cultures, and races at our firm incites higher creativity and engagement, and ensures that both our employees and clients feel safe and at-home within our spaces.
5. Commitment to Clients
At MoveMate, we value the trust of our partners and clients, and aim to go above and beyond no matter the circumstance. As our firm continues to grow, we are dedicated to positioning our business around solving moving and delivery pains while making sure that our product remains meaningful. We engage in personalized follow-ups with every client to gain feedback on their experience, and actively work to make sure that all their pain points are relieved.
6. Personal Development
By providing our employees seminars and workshops, we encourage our employees to strive toward their professional goals and show our devotion to their personal development.
What’s in it for you?
As a Software Developer, you will support various development initiatives and will contribute to all technical growth plans at MoveMate. You will acquire experience in software development, an ability to keep up-to-date with deadlines, and strong analytical skills. In carrying out your duties, you will have a significant impact on the firm’s technical advancement and be able to see the fruits of your labour through new investments and increased sales.
In this role, you will have the opportunity to grow and develop skill sets beyond software development. While 75% of your training will be focused on this technical area, the remaining 25% will be reserved for learning other facets of the business, including Marketing, Operations, Admin or Sales.
Within this role, you will also receive comprehensive training on the start-up ecosystem and engage in meaningful conversations with MoveMate’s founders and managers through our company town halls, workshops, and happy hours.
Your goals are, but are not limited to
- Performing coding assignments.
- Reviewing code work for accuracy and functionality.
- Creating and implementing design plans.
- Analyzing code segments regularly.
- Keeping up-to-date with industry trends and technology developments.
- Implementing high level functionalities.
- Refactoring & optimizing code.
- Implementing Unit & Integration Tests.
- Contributing in maintaining deployment scripts.
- Helping with debugging, support and maintenance.
What we are looking for
We are looking for highly motivated individuals that are willing to work hard, learn and grow exponentially. Candidates must be people-oriented, flexible and able to adapt to new situations frequently.
General requirements
- Currently working towards a Bachelor’s degree in Information Technology, Computer Science, or another related field.
- Extensive knowledge of software development and its technologies
- Eagerness to learn and explore
- Experience with the following:
- Python and/or JavaScript
- Any other languages is a plus: C, C++, C# and/or Java
- Web frameworks: HTML, CSS
- Versioning control: Git
- Docker - Kubernetes
- Database: SQL & NoSQL
Good to have
- Good understanding programming paradigms, specifically OOP.
- Strong algorithmic and logic skills.
- Strong analytical skills.
- Knowledge of Design Patterns.
- Solid coding skills.
- Strong communication skills.
- Good time management skills.
- Bilingual in French and English preferred.
What we offer
- Competitive salary
- Generous stock option package
- Telehealth medicine service including free mental health and wellness treatment
-------------
À propos de MoveMate
Chez MoveMate, nous nous engageons à devenir l'application de premier choix pour le déménagement et la livraison de gros objets en Amérique du Nord.
Nous avons créé un marché bilatéral mettant en relation des individus et des entreprises ayant un besoin de déménagement ou de livraison avec des contractants indépendants appelés "Mates" qui ont les outils, la main d'œuvre et le véhicule nécessaires pour faciliter le service.
Chez MoveMate, nous nous plaçons à chaque étape du parcours du client déménageant: aider les gens à entrer et sortir des objets d’un entrepôt, vendre des biens dont ils veulent se débarrasser, déménager d'un appartement à l'autre ou d'un bureau à l'autre, aider les clients à meubler leur appartement en leur livrant tout article qu'ils auraient pu acheter d'occasion en ligne (Kijiji, Facebook Marketplace, etc.) ou chez un détaillant, et plus encore!
Nous avons déployé notre plateforme début 2019 et avons depuis aidé des milliers de clients à travers le Canada. Nous nous développons très rapidement. L’année dernière, nous avons eu une croissance de nos revenus de 400% et nous cherchions à maintenir cet élan.
Nous sommes un groupe diversifié de jeunes professionnels motivés qui recherchent des personnes assidues et dynamiques pour rejoindre notre communauté à mesure que nous allons de l'avant!
Quels sont les avantages pour vous?
En tant que Développeur(euse), vous soutiendrez diverses initiatives de développement et contribuerez à tous les plans de croissance technique chez MoveMate. Vous acquerrez de l'expérience en développement logiciel, une capacité à respecter les délais, ainsi que de solides compétences analytiques. Dans l'exercice de vos fonctions, vous aurez un impact significatif sur l'avancement technique de l'entreprise et pourrez voir les fruits de votre travail à travers de nouveaux investissements et une augmentation des ventes.Dans ce rôle, vous aurez l'opportunité de grandir et de développer des compétences au-delà du développement logiciel. Bien que 75 % de votre formation soit axée sur cette partie technique, les 25 % restants seront réservés à l'apprentissage d'autres aspects de l'entreprise, y compris le marketing, les opérations, l'administration ou les ventes.Dans ce rôle, vous recevrez également une formation complète sur l'écosystème des startups et vous participerez à des discussions enrichissantes avec les fondateurs et les managers de MoveMate lors de nos réunions d'entreprise, ateliers et moments de convivialité.
Vos objectifs incluent, mais ne sont pas limités à :
- Réaliser des tâches de codage.
- Vérifier l'exactitude et la fonctionnalité du code.
- Créer et mettre en œuvre des plans de conception.
- Analyser régulièrement des segments de code.
- Se tenir à jour avec les tendances de l'industrie et les évolutions technologiques.
- Mettre en œuvre des fonctionnalités de haut niveau.
- Refactoriser et optimiser le code.
- Implémenter des tests unitaires et d'intégration.
- Contribuer à la maintenance des scripts de déploiement.
- Aider au débogage, au support et à la maintenance.
Description du poste
Nous recherchons des personnes hautement motivées, prêtes à travailler dur, à apprendre et à évoluer de manière exponentielle. Les candidats doivent être orientés vers les gens, avoir un esprit entrepreneurial, être très flexibles et capables de s'adapter fréquemment et de manière inattendue à de nouvelles situations.
Exigences générales
- Baccalauréat en Technologies de l'Information, Informatique ou dans un domaine connexe.
- Connaissance approfondie du développement logiciel et de ses technologies.
- Envie d'apprendre et d'explorer.
- Expérience avec les technologies suivantes :
- Python et/ou JavaScript.
- Toute autre langue est un plus : C, C++, C# et/ou Java.
- Frameworks web : HTML, CSS.
- Contrôle de version : Git.
- Docker - Kubernetes.
- Bases de données : SQL & NoSQL.
Compétences appréciées
- Bonne compréhension des paradigmes de programmation, en particulier la POO (Programmation Orientée Objet).
- Solides compétences en algorithmes et logique.
- Solides compétences analytiques.
- Connaissance des Design Patterns.
- Solides compétences en codage.
- Bonnes compétences en communication.
- Bonnes compétences en gestion du temps.
- Bilingue en français et en anglais (préféré).
Ce que nous offrons
- Salaire compétitif
- Plan d'options sur actions généreux
- Service de télémédecine incluant des soins gratuits en santé mentale et bien-être
Les valeurs de MoveMate
Chez MoveMate, nous sommes fiers de rester fidèles à nos valeurs à tout moment. Nous évaluons constamment ces principes pour nous assurer qu'ils reflètent la culture d'entreprise que nous cherchons à maintenir.
1. Ténacité
Chez MoveMate, nous formons nos employés à exploiter leur esprit entrepreneurial pour stimuler l'innovation et la résolution de problèmes qui amélioreront continuellement nos produits et services, et nous permettront de réagir rapidement lorsque nos clients auront besoin d'aide. Les employés bénéficiant d'une autonomie importante, seront compensés pour leur transpiration supplémentaire par une récompense supplémentaire.
2. Impact
Chez MoveMate, notre cadre de “sweat equity” réussit parce que notre équipe croit à la vision de MoveMate ; ils comprennent que leur travail fait partie d'une ambition plus grande de ce que le monde peut devenir : efficace et écologique. MoveMate imagine un monde où les entreprises et les clients utilisent MoveMate pour transporter leurs marchandises grâce à nos capacités logistiques avancées qui réduisent la congestion des routes et optimisent les itinéraires de livraison afin de garantir que toutes les voitures et tous les camions voyagent à pleine capacité. Nous voulons avoir un impact au niveau mondial en contribuant à la création de villes plus intelligentes qui adoptent une approche multidimensionnelle de la durabilité.
3. Transparence
MoveMate s'engage à être ouvert et honnête sur tous les aspects de ses services. Notre objectif est de rendre chaque partie de notre processus de réservation et notre modèle de tarification transparents afin que nos clients sachent exactement ce qui leur est facturé et pourquoi, ainsi que comment se préparer correctement pour un déménagement.
4. Diversité
Chez MoveMate, nous nous sommes engagés à diversifier notre lieu de travail aux niveaux de la direction, gestionnaire, des consultants et des analystes/stagiaires. Nous reconnaissons la valeur d'avoir une variété de perspectives à notre table, et comprenons que la représentation de divers milieux, cultures et races dans notre entreprise incite à une plus grande créativité et à un plus grand engagement, et garantit que nos employés et nos clients se sentent en sécurité et à l'aise dans nos espaces.
5. Engagement envers les clients
Chez MoveMate, nous accordons une grande importance à la confiance de nos partenaires et de nos clients, et nous nous efforçons de nous surpasser, quelles que soient les circonstances. Au fur et à mesure que notre entreprise grandit, nous nous efforçons de positionner notre activité pour résoudre les problèmes de déménagement et de livraison tout en veillant à ce que notre produit reste intéressant. Nous assurons un suivi personnalisé auprès de chaque client afin d'obtenir un retour d'information sur son expérience, et nous nous engageons activement à faire en sorte que tous ses soucis soient résolus.
6. Développement personnel
En proposant à nos employés des séminaires et des ateliers, nous les encourageons à atteindre leurs objectifs professionnels et montrons notre dévouement à leur développement personnel.
Job Type: Full-time
Pay: $75,000.00 per year
Benefits:
- Paid time off
Schedule:
- Monday to Friday
Ability to commute/relocate:
- Montréal, QC H3C 4J9: reliably commute or plan to relocate before starting work (required)
Work Location: Hybrid remote in Montréal, QC H3C 4J9